php语言怎么设置指定文件夹

fiy 其他 105

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在PHP中,你可以使用`chdir()`函数来设置指定的文件夹。

    `chdir()`函数用于更改当前的工作目录。它可以接受一个参数,即要设置的目标文件夹的路径。以下是设置指定文件夹的步骤:

    1. 首先,确定目标文件夹的路径。例如,如果你想设置的文件夹路径是`/path/to/folder`,那么你需要先确认该文件夹的实际路径。

    2. 使用`chdir()`函数设置文件夹的路径。你可以像下面这样使用函数:

    “`
    chdir(‘/path/to/folder’);
    “`

    上述代码将设置当前工作目录为`/path/to/folder`。

    3. 做完其他的操作后,你可以将当前工作目录恢复到默认的目录。你可以使用`chdir()`函数再次设置默认目录,或者使用`getcwd()`函数获取当前目录的路径,然后再次使用`chdir()`函数设置回去。

    下面是一个完整的示例代码,演示了如何设置指定文件夹:

    “`php
    // 设定目标文件夹路径
    $targetFolder = ‘/path/to/folder’;

    // 设置目标文件夹
    chdir($targetFolder);

    // 输出当前工作目录
    echo ‘当前工作目录:’ . getcwd();

    // 可以在这里做其他操作

    // 恢复到默认目录
    chdir(‘/default/path’);

    // 再次输出当前工作目录
    echo ‘恢复到默认目录后的当前工作目录:’ . getcwd();
    “`

    希望以上信息能够帮助到你设置指定文件夹。在使用`chdir()`函数改变工作目录时,需要注意目标文件夹的路径是否正确,以及是否具有足够的访问权限。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    使用 PHP 语言可以通过以下几种方式来设置指定文件夹:

    1. 使用 `chdir()` 函数改变当前工作目录:这种方式可以将当前工作目录更改为指定的文件夹。例如:

    “`php
    chdir(“/path/to/directory”);
    “`

    2. 使用 `opendir()` 函数打开目录:这种方式可以打开指定的文件夹,返回一个目录句柄,然后可以使用其他函数来操作该目录。例如:

    “`php
    $dir = opendir(“/path/to/directory”);
    “`

    3. 使用 `scandir()` 函数获取目录内容:这种方式可以获取指定文件夹中的文件和子文件夹列表。例如:

    “`php
    $files = scandir(“/path/to/directory”);
    “`

    4. 使用 `mkdir()` 函数创建新目录:这种方式可以在指定的文件夹下创建新的子文件夹。例如:

    “`php
    mkdir(“/path/to/directory/new_folder”);
    “`

    5. 使用 `rmdir()` 函数删除目录:这种方式可以删除指定的文件夹,前提是文件夹必须为空。例如:

    “`php
    rmdir(“/path/to/directory”);
    “`

    以上是使用 PHP 语言设置指定文件夹的几种常用方法。根据具体需求和场景,可以灵活选择适合的方式来操作文件夹。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在PHP中,可以通过以下几种方法来设置指定文件夹。

    1. 使用`chdir`函数改变当前工作目录:
    “`
    chdir(‘/path/to/folder’);
    “`
    这将改变当前工作目录为”/path/to/folder”,之后所有文件操作将基于该目录。

    2. 使用绝对路径访问文件夹:
    “`
    $folder = ‘/path/to/folder’;
    “`
    然后可以使用该变量来访问文件夹中的文件。

    3. 使用相对路径访问文件夹:
    “`
    $folder = ‘folder’;
    “`
    表示当前PHP脚本所在的目录下的”folder”文件夹。

    以下是如何在具体情况下使用这些方法的示例。

    ## 示例一:使用`chdir`函数改变当前工作目录
    “`php

    “`
    在上面的示例中,我们使用`chdir`函数将当前工作目录更改为”/path/to/folder”。然后,我们使用相对路径创建了一个名为”example.txt”的文件。由于当前工作目录已更改,文件将被创建在”/path/to/folder/example.txt”。

    ## 示例二:使用绝对路径访问文件夹
    “`php

    “`
    在上面的示例中,我们将文件夹路径存储在变量`$folder`中。然后,我们可以使用该变量和文件名来创建文件。

    ## 示例三:使用相对路径访问文件夹
    “`php

    “`
    在上面的示例中,我们将文件夹路径存储在相对于当前PHP脚本所在目录的变量`$folder`中。然后,我们可以使用该变量和文件名来创建文件。

    无论哪种方法,只要将文件夹路径设置正确,你就可以在指定的文件夹中执行各种文件操作。请确保具有足够的权限来执行这些操作。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部